软土地区高层建筑全逆作施工技术研究

Research on Techniques of Top-down Construction Method in Soft Soil Region

【摘要】 全逆作法施工在软土地区高层建筑工程中广泛应用,但由于软土地区的单桩承载力有限,在地下室逆作的同时,上部结构同步施工的层数受限。本文研究将高承载力的桩基,如桩端后注浆钻孔灌注桩、扩底桩、巨型桩等,在软土地区全逆作施工中应用的可行性;分别对于一柱一桩和一桩多桩两种逆作施工竖向承载体系,论证了高承载力的桩基的应用可以加快上部结构施工;总结了全逆作施工中的关键施工技术,如立柱的不均匀沉降、梁柱板墙的节点、一柱多桩的转换梁板等;提出了软土地区高层建筑全逆作施工总体方案制定应遵循的一些基本原则,如主楼群房的逆顺组合、全逆作的逆顺分界选择、挖土方式选择等。

【Abstract】 Top-down construction method has been widely used for tall building in soft soil region, but because of the limited bearing capacity of pile in soft soil, the construction speed of structure above ground is limited, while the basement is constructed reversely.In this paper, the feasibility of pile with high bearing capacity, such as post-grouting bored concrete pile, pedestal pile, huge pile and so on, used in top-down construction is studied. The construction speed increase of structure above ground is proved to be available when those high bearing piles are used in top-down construction, both in the vertical load transition system of one column over one pile and one column over several piles. The key techniques of top-down construction, such as uneven settlement of piles, the connection of beam and column and plate and wall, are summarized and given. Due to the great importance and complexity of general construction plan for tall building using top-down method, some basic rules, such as the combination and dividing line between top-down method and tradition method, the excavation method and so on, are suggested.
